Her simple act of going to an all-white school … Webb13 mars 2024 · Ruby Bridges and Kamala Harris, March 2024. Ruby finished elementary school and graduated from high school. Bridges went on to become a travel agent for American Express. Mrs. Ruby Bridges Hall is married and has four sons. She still lives in New Orleans. In 1999, she wrote a children's book, Through My Eyes, telling her story. thacher house ojai
